Cryptography is one of the core foundations of modern digital security. Every time data is transmitted over the internet, cryptographic principles are working in the background to protect confidentiality, integrity, and authenticity.
Modern certification exams related to cryptography no longer focus only on memorizing formulas or definitions. Instead, they evaluate how well you understand how security concepts are applied inside real systems such as secure communication, authentication, and data protection.
This shift makes cryptography more practical and system-oriented, especially for learners who are new to security concepts and need a clear understanding of how everything connects in real-world environments.
Introduction-to-Cryptography Study Reference : Cryptography Preparation Notes
At its core, cryptography revolves around a few essential principles including encryption, decryption, hashing, and key management. Each of these plays a different role in protecting digital information.
Encryption ensures that data remains unreadable to unauthorized users, while decryption allows authorized systems to restore it to its original form. Hashing, on the other hand, focuses on verifying data integrity rather than hiding content.
Understanding these differences is important because many exam scenarios test whether you can identify the correct security method based on real-world use cases.
In exam-style scenarios, cryptography is often applied to real situations such as secure online transactions, encrypted messaging systems, or password protection mechanisms.
Instead of asking direct theoretical questions, scenarios usually describe a problem and require you to determine which cryptographic method best solves it.
This makes it important to understand not just what each concept is, but when and why it is used in practical systems.
One of the most common challenges is confusion between similar concepts such as encryption and hashing. While both are used for security, their purposes are fundamentally different.
Another difficulty is understanding how keys work in encryption systems, especially when distinguishing between symmetric and asymmetric approaches.
These concepts become easier when they are connected to real applications rather than studied in isolation.
A practical approach to learning cryptography is to focus on real-world use cases. For example, think about how websites secure login data, how messaging apps protect conversations, and how financial systems safeguard transactions.
This method helps transform abstract concepts into practical understanding, making it easier to analyze scenario-based questions in exams.
Over time, learners develop a clearer mental model of how security layers work together to protect digital systems.
Cryptography is not just a theoretical subject—it is a practical framework that powers modern digital security. Building a strong conceptual foundation and connecting ideas to real-world systems is the key to mastering this topic effectively.
No responses yet.